Dutchy posted:Plus I'm maybe the only person on the planet that thinks this, but I love the Browns minimalist aesthetic and brown/orange color scheme and it'd have been a tragedy to replace it with another variety of angry cat or something. Nah, the Browns uniforms are classic and almost universally regarded. They’ve tried twice to update them to something modern, once for like one year in like 1984 and it lasted like a single preseason game, and then that awful pattern they went to in 2015 that everyone hated so badly they went back to their classic uniforms as soon as the 5-year redesign window opened up.
